Top Attractions & Must-Visit Places in Maials, Spain

While Maials might be small, it's packed with character. Here are a few places you won't want to miss:

  • The Church of Sant Martí: A stunning example of local architecture, this church is a must-see for its historical significance and beautiful design.
  • The Maials Castle Ruins: Explore the remnants of this historic castle, imagining life in a bygone era. The views from the ruins are simply spectacular.
  • Local Walking Trails: Discover the stunning countryside surrounding Maials on foot. Numerous trails offer breathtaking views and a chance to connect with nature.

When’s the Best Time to Go?

The best time to visit Maials depends on your preferences. Spring and autumn offer pleasant weather, fewer crowds, and vibrant colours in the countryside. Summer can be hot, but perfect for swimming and outdoor activities. Winter can be chilly, but offers a unique charm.
